Congratulations to GRADSÂ’ "A DollÂ’s House" on their opening weekend. As with PlayloversÂ’ "Assassins", the practice of offering discount tickets to lure customers to the show, thus ensuring early word-of-mouth, seems to have succeeded admirably.

To that end, BLAK YAK Theatre has decided to follow suit. This coming Friday, June 23rd, sees the opening night of "Bumpy Angels" at the Kalamunda Performing Arts Centre, and we would like to offer discount tickets to all patrons.

As some people are aware, BLAK YAK has recently suffered a massive (400%) increase in our rehearsal costs. Unfortunately, we have had to increase our ticket prices to save us ourselves from bankruptcy. As President of BLAK YAK, I am openly apologising to anyone who is concerned by this price increase, and I hope youÂ’ll still consider coming to see our show.

Ticket prices for "Bumpy Angels" are normally $14 and $12, but for this Friday opening night only, tickets will be available at $10 and $8. Anyone who has already booked a ticket, will still be charged the discount price at the door.

I will echo Grant’s assertion that this is not a ‘cheap final rehearsal’ - these wonderful girls have been rehearsing for three months and they’re sick of an empty auditorium - they want an audience NOW!

If you canÂ’t make the show this week at Kalamunda, please note that we will next take "Bumpy Angels" to our regular venue: The City of Gosnells Don Russell Performing Arts Centre in Thornlie, for July 1, 7, 8, 12, 14, 15 (Sat; Fri, Sat; Wed, Fri, Sat). This will be followed by a two-night season at Hackett Hall (thanks to the kind people at Playlovers) on July 21 & 22 (Fri & Sat). Finally, the grand tour ends at the Kwinana Performing Arts Centre on July 28 & 29 (Fri & Sat). So, no excuses for anyone missing the show. Hope to see you there.
